Financial disclosures from New York’s congressional delegation show gaps between members’ public positions and how they themselves have made their wealth — even as its members join the chorus of lawmakers fixed on affordability ahead of the midterms.
That discrepancy is especially clear when it comes to stock trading.
The members with some of the highest median net worths in the delegation are also among the most active stock traders in the group, according to NOTUS’ analysis of their most recent personal finance disclosures.
